What's Included at These Prices
- Old faucet removal. Disconnecting and clearing out corroded fittings or old sealant.
- New faucet installation. Kitchen, bathroom, or bar faucets — any standard configuration.
- Supply line replacement. Fresh supply lines when the old ones are worn or brittle.
- Leak testing. Full water-on test under the sink before we consider it done.
- Sealant & caulking. Base of the faucet sealed against the counter or sink deck.
What Changes the Price
Three factors move faucet installation quotes in South Florida more than anything else: access and condition (older installations, corrosion from humidity and salt air, hard-to-reach spots), materials (what needs replacing vs. reusing), and scope creep (small extras discovered mid-job). Do you supply the faucet, or do I?
Most customers buy the faucet themselves so they get the exact style they want — we install it. We can also pick one up for you at cost if you would rather not shop.
My old faucet's supply lines are corroded — is that extra?
Corroded or brittle supply lines are common on faucets over 10 years old, especially with Miami's water minerals. We replace them as part of the job at the quoted supply-line rate rather than forcing the old ones to work.
Can you install a faucet with 3 holes when my old one only used 1?
Yes, as long as your sink or counter has the matching pre-drilled holes, or we can install a deck plate to cover extra holes if you are downsizing to fewer holes.
How long does a faucet swap take?
A standard replacement takes 45-60 minutes. Pull-down or touchless models with extra hoses can take up to 90 minutes.
Do you handle outdoor/hose bib faucets?
Yes, as a handyman-level swap on existing lines. Anything requiring new piping runs or a permit gets referred to a licensed plumber.
Will you check for leaks after installing?
Always — we run the water at full pressure and check every connection under the sink before we call the job complete.
